Hormone Testing: Which Cycle Day Gives Real Answers

The right day to test depends on the hormone. Day 3, about days 2 to 5 of your period, suits FSH, LH, and estradiol; progesterone is drawn mid-luteal, roughly 7 days after ovulation. AMH, thyroid hormone, prolactin, and testosterone are not cycle-dependent and can be checked on any day.

Why does cycle timing change hormone results?

Reproductive hormones rise and fall dramatically across a single cycle, so when a test is drawn often matters more than the value itself. Estrogen climbs toward ovulation, luteinizing hormone spikes to trigger it, and progesterone rises only afterward. A number that looks 'high' or 'low' can be perfectly normal for the day it was collected.

Cycle day is counted from day 1, the first day of full flow. According to the American College of Obstetricians and Gynecologists, a normal adult cycle runs about 24 to 38 days 1, which means a fixed calendar day does not land in the same phase for everyone. Matching each hormone to its informative window is the whole point of timing.

Which hormones are tested on day 3?

Day 3 — early in the bleeding phase, usually days 2 to 5 — is the standard window for a baseline read on the ovaries. Follicle-stimulating hormone (FSH), luteinizing hormone (LH), and estradiol drawn here give context on ovarian reserve and how hard the brain is working to recruit an egg 2.

Anti-Müllerian hormone (AMH) is the exception, since it stays relatively steady across the cycle and can be measured on any day 2. Testing FSH and estradiol together on day 3 matters because a high estradiol can mask a high FSH. When should progesterone and other hormones be tested?

Progesterone follows a different clock, since it only rises after ovulation. According to the American Society for Reproductive Medicine, a mid-luteal progesterone drawn about 7 days after ovulation — near day 21 in a 28-day cycle — is used to confirm that ovulation happened 3. For longer cycles the timing shifts later, so the draw is counted back about 7 days from the next expected period.

Several hormones are not tied to cycle day at all. Thyroid hormone (TSH), prolactin, and testosterone can be checked on any day, though testosterone and prolactin read most reliably in the morning. What if your cycles are irregular?

Irregular cycles break the tidy day-3-and-day-21 model, because there is no predictable ovulation to count from. With conditions like PCOS, or during the natural transitions of adolescence and perimenopause, clinicians often rely on AMH, random draws, or repeated testing rather than a fixed calendar day 4.

Life stage colors interpretation as well. FSH and estradiol swing widely across the menopause transition, so a single elevated FSH does not by itself confirm menopause 4. In the first years after menarche, cycles are commonly anovulatory, which also blunts the meaning of a mid-luteal progesterone. Ordering fewer, better-timed tests usually beats a scattershot panel. Repeat testing over a few months can reveal a pattern a one-time panel would miss.

A day 3 test is a blood draw early in your period, usually on days 2 to 5, that measures FSH, LH, and estradiol together for a baseline read on the ovaries. AMH can be added on the same visit because it does not depend on cycle day.

Some hormones, yes. AMH, thyroid hormone, prolactin, and testosterone are relatively stable across the cycle. Others, like FSH, estradiol, and progesterone, are only informative on specific days, so testing them at random can produce misleading results.

Count back about 7 days from the day your next period is expected, rather than assuming day 21. In a 35-day cycle, that lands closer to day 28. Confirming ovulation signs first helps you time the draw so the result actually reflects the luteal phase.

Day 1 is the first day of full menstrual flow, not light spotting the day before. Counting consistently from full flow keeps cycle-day timing accurate, which matters when a test window is only a day or two wide.

When irregular results deserve review

  • Periods that are absent for three months or highly irregular are a reason to seek clinician review.
  • Unexplained weight change, hair loss, or new excess hair growth alongside irregular cycles is a reason to seek clinician review.
  • Any bleeding after menopause is a reason to seek prompt clinician review.
  • Difficulty conceiving after 12 months, or 6 months if over 35, is a reason to seek clinician review.
